A person intending to appeal to the court is required to file a notice of appeal within 14 days of the decision. Please refer to the Court of Appeal Rules, 2022 for all requirements for filing an appeal.
The matter will be listed for Case Management in preparation for the hearing. A Case Management notice will be issued by the Registry.
Appeals and Applications are listed for hearing on a first-in-first-out basis (FIFO). The Court will issue and serve hearing notices.

In civil matters, either party may draft the order and serve the other party for approval. If approved, the party who extracted the order requests the Deputy Registrar in writing to have the same signed. If not approved after 7 days, the order is listed before the Deputy Registrar for settlement.
In criminal matters, the Order is extracted by the Court.
